Schneider Electric Young Leaders Masters Scholarship 2026 Germany | Full Tuition Fee Coverage (100%)

Category

Masters

Details

The Schneider Electric Young Leaders Scholarship 2026 is a fully funded postgraduate opportunity for international students to pursue master’s programmes in Energy and Sustainability in Germany.

Applicants must be admitted to one of the following programmes at the EUREF-Campus Düsseldorf:

  • Master of Science in Management of Smart and Sustainable Energy Systems
  • Master of Science in Sustainable Energy and Hydrogen Infrastructures

 

How to Apply:

  1. Apply for one of the eligible MSc programmes at EUREF-Campus Düsseldorf.
  2. Submit:
    • Motivation letter (addressed to Schneider Electric).
    • Curriculum Vitae (CV).
    • Proof of German language skills.
  3. Send documents to the course coordinator’s email (listed on programme page).
  4. Participate in the multi-stage selection process, including online interviews.
  5. Await final decision (March/April 2026).

Eligibility Criteria

Applicants must:

  • Successfully complete the selection process for one of the eligible MSc programmes.
  • Have an excellent academic background in a technical field (e.g., electrical engineering, energy engineering, mechanical engineering, automation, process engineering, building technology, sustainability, or similar).
  • Possess at least 1 year of relevant postgraduate work experience (sales, project management, business development, or service experience valued).
  • Demonstrate German language proficiency (minimum B1/B2 level) and willingness to improve further.
  • Be flexible and willing to work across Germany, Austria, or Switzerland after studies.
  • Show enthusiasm for sustainability, a digital mindset, and alignment with Schneider Electric’s IMPACT values.

Financial Benefits

  • Full tuition fee coverage (100%).
  • Paid working student contract (up to 20 hours per week) with Schneider Electric.
  • Living allowance covered through part-time work.
  • Hands-on industry experience during studies.
